Discover the Rich History of Koprivshtitsa

When travelers step into Koprivshtitsa, they’re instantly transported back to Bulgaria’s vibrant past, as if the cobblestoned streets whisper tales of revolution and resilience.

This charming town played a pivotal role in the 1876 April Uprising against Ottoman rule. Visitors often find themselves captivated by stories of local heroes, like the brave women who fought for freedom.

As they stroll, they might hear guides recounting how the town’s spirit ignited a national consciousness. One traveler recalled feeling an emotional connection, as if the very air pulsed with history.

Koprivshtitsa’s rich heritage truly brings Bulgaria’s past to life.

Enjoying Local Cuisine by the River

While wandering through the charming streets of Koprivshtitsa, visitors often find themselves drawn to the inviting riverfront restaurants that serve up delicious local cuisine.

These spots not only offer stunning views of the flowing river but also tantalizing dishes like banitsa and kavarma.

One traveler shared how the fresh, homemade bread paired perfectly with the savory stews.

Locals are friendly, often eager to recommend their favorite meals or share stories about the town’s rich history.

Dining by the river creates a memorable experience, blending the flavors of Bulgaria with the serene sounds of nature, making it a must-try for every visitor.
